Transcribed Image Text:Enter the coefficients directly from the balanced chemical equation.
*Do not reduce to lowest terms.*
For example: If 3 moles H₂ react with 3 moles O₂, enter "3" for each, not "1".
---
According to the following reaction:
\[ 2\text{HCl (aq)} + \text{Ba(OH)}_2 \text{(aq)} \rightarrow \text{BaCl}_2 \text{(aq)} + 2\text{H}_2\text{O (l)} \]
What would you multiply "moles of hydrochloric acid" by to convert to the units "moles of water"?
